BASIS DATA
Pada pertemuan kali ini saya akan
menjelaskan sedikit tentang basis data. Apa kalian tahu pengertian basis data?
Nah disini saya akan membahas sedikit tentang basis data yang saya dapat dari
penjelasan dosen saya ketika di kelas.
Basis data adalah suatu tempat
untuk meletakkan data yang dapat diatur penempatannya atau juga bisa disebut
dengan kumpulan data yang terintegrasi yang disimpan pada penyimpanan
elektronik. Dengan prinsip sebagai pengaturan dan bertujuan agar cepat dan
mudah pada saat pencarian data. Selain itu pada basis data juga ada program
aplikasinya atau softwarenya yaitu sering disebut dengan DBMS ( Database
Manajemen System) software atau aplikasi yang digunakan yaitu contohnya excel,
acces, SQL, oracle, dB2, dbase III, dan IV, the base, dan lain-lain.
System basis data juga merupakan
gabungan dari basis data dan DBMS, oh ya sebelum saya lupa saya ingin
memberitahu kepada kalian bahwa basis data itu sendiri merupakan koleksi –
koleksi data. Didalam basis data ada komponen sistem basis data yaitu terdiri
dari :
1. Hardware, contonya jika tidak ada hardwarenya yaitu komputer maka kita tidak bisa
mengerjakan softwarenya.
2. Software, contohnya DBMS itu sendiri.
3. Program aplikasi yang lain, contohnya yaitu jika kita mempunyai aplikasi seperti acces
dan tidak memiliki aplikasi pendukungnya seperti Visual Basic, maka aplikasinya tidak
akan jalan.
4. Sistem Operasi, sistem operasi ini yang membuat software bisa berjalan.
5. User, dalam menjalankan software yang paling penting harus ada usernya jika tidak ada
user maka softwarenya tidak akan bisa jalan.
1. Hardware, contonya jika tidak ada hardwarenya yaitu komputer maka kita tidak bisa
mengerjakan softwarenya.
2. Software, contohnya DBMS itu sendiri.
3. Program aplikasi yang lain, contohnya yaitu jika kita mempunyai aplikasi seperti acces
dan tidak memiliki aplikasi pendukungnya seperti Visual Basic, maka aplikasinya tidak
akan jalan.
4. Sistem Operasi, sistem operasi ini yang membuat software bisa berjalan.
5. User, dalam menjalankan software yang paling penting harus ada usernya jika tidak ada
user maka softwarenya tidak akan bisa jalan.
Dalam sistem manajemen Basis Data
terbagi atas sistem manajemen file tradisional dan sistem manajemen file
modern.
Sistem Manajemen File Tradisional
Kelemahan :
a)
Datanya rangkap atau redudansi data.
b)
Datanya tidak konsisten atau inkonsisten data.
c)
Program orientied.
d)
Datanya terisolasi.
e)
Keamanan data tidak terjamin karena disimpan di
berbagai tempat.
Kelebihan :
a)
Jika ada kerusakan data di bagian satu bagian,
bagian lain tetap berjalan. Karena datanya tersimpan tidak hanya di satu bagian
saja.
Sistem Manajemen File Modern
Kelemahan :
a)
Kerusakan data di 1 bagian menyebabkan semua
bagian tidak bisa berjalan.
b)
Perlu strong besar atau tempat penyimpanan yang
besar.
c)
Perlu tenaga ahli.
d)
Biaya mahal jika perlu banyak tenaga ahli.
Kelebihan :
a)
Mengurangi redudansi terhadap kerangkapan data.
b)
Datanya menjadi konsisten.
c)
Datanya menjadi orientied.
d)
Keamanan terhadap datanya terjamin.
Dalam basis data terdapat
istilah-istilah seperti entity, atribut, dan data value. Dibawah ini saya akan
menjelaskan satu persatu mengenai istilah-istilah tersebut.
1. Entity
(Entitas)
Merupakan
objek yang bisa dibedakan.
Contoh
: - dilihat dari universitas gunadarma yaitu entitas mahasiswa,
dosen, mahasiswa, karyawan dan lain-lain.
dosen, mahasiswa, karyawan dan lain-lain.
- dilihat dari alfamart atau supermarket yaitu entitas barang,
pembeli, pengawas, supplier, dan lain-lain.
pembeli, pengawas, supplier, dan lain-lain.
- dilihat dari rumah sakit yaitu entitas pasien, dokter,
perawat, obat, dan lain-lain.
perawat, obat, dan lain-lain.
2. Atribut
Merupakan
ciri-ciri atau karakteristik pada entitas.
Contoh
: - mahasiswa atributnya seperti npm, nama, alamat, jenis
kelamin, dan lain-lain.
kelamin, dan lain-lain.
-
barang atributnya seperti kode barang, nama barang, jumlah
barang, dan lain-lain.
barang, dan lain-lain.
3. Data value
Merupakan
nilai dari suatu data.
Contoh :
- NPM รจ didalam kotak NPM
disamping
adalah merupakan nilai data.
adalah merupakan nilai data.
- Nama
1. Ali
2. Budi
3. Aulia
Tidak ada komentar:
Posting Komentar